This paper introduces a novel speech enhancement system based on a wavelet denoising framework. In this system, the noisy speech is first preprocessed using a generalized spectral subtraction method to initially lower the noise level with negligible speech distortion. A perceptual wavelet transform is then used to decompose the resulting speech signal into critical bands. Threshold estimation is implemented that is both time and frequency dependent, providing robustness to non-stationary and correlated noisy environments. Finally, to eliminate the “musical noise” artifact, we apply a modified Ephraim/Malah suppression rule to the thresholding operation adaptive denoising. Both objective and subjective experiments prove that the new speech enhancement system is capable of significant noise reduction with little speech distortion.
